Just delivered my 3rd child n b4 going bk to work, decide to place all my 3 children in moriah childcare; previously, my 2 older kids are in kindergarten. I was rather uncertain of my decision to put my children in ccc initially but decide to try it out during the June holiday... My observation for the past 3 weeks in moriah cc is ;
1) the place is kept v. Clean, this ccc engage 2 cleaners from iss who station there just to keep the place Spick n span
2) well- ventilated/ non air-con environment , high ceiling
3) responsible teacher- the teacher spotted that the spray I bring to school is expired, I never even notice the fine prints when I pack into my child's bag! Another example is They inform me immediately when my child did not eat the buns for tea

4) the teacher-student ratio seems to be high but the teachers can handle the children well
5) principal was very much involve in the day-to-day operation of the ccc
6) the fees is rather affordable, seems to me they r a non- profitable organization
7) food is prepared by in- house cook, food look well- balance

My main concern is still the teacher- student ratio, especially for nursery level. My no.2 still protest going to ccc every morning, but my elder one looks like he have a good time in school. I'm still observing for this trial period, but overall I would say I feel quite satisfy with the ccc.
